Great NW location near downtown (2.5 miles from Mayo) and extremely convenient. Private end unit with a patio that backs up to a large yard/common area. Spacious bedrooms, open main floor layout with laundry. Very clean and a great space you can enjoy living in.

Home Features:
- New stainless appliances
- Additional guest parking located right off of the patio
- 2006 2 story townhome
- Approx 1,200 sqft.
- Lawn care and snow removal included
- 2 spacious bedrooms (upper level)
- 1 full bath(upper level)
- 1 Stall attached garage
- Main floor laundry

** Owner-managed and is your direct local contact. It's important to us to be great landlords and we appreciate working with great people. Past tenant recommendations are available upon request. Owner is a licensed Realtor.

Lawn and snow care included. Available June 2 , minimum 12-month lease, and with longer-term rent is negotiable. No smoking and no pets (small well-trained pets may be considered and are negotiable) subject to additional terms. Must be well qualified with acceptable rental and employment history. Subject to a background check and credit score.

Association dues are included and paid by the owner that covers snow removal and lawn care. Tenant is responsible for electric, water, gas, and garbage removal.

2616 Charles Ct NW, Rochester, MN 55901 is a 2 bedroom, 1.5 bathroom, 1,185 sqft townhouse built in 2006. This property is not currently available for sale. 2616 Charles Ct NW was last sold on Dec 11, 2014 for $113,000. The current Trulia Estimate for 2616 Charles Ct NW is $218,600.
